Listing ID: 38268908
11/59 Balmain Road, Leichhardt NSW 2040
Affordable and Convenient space *** Application Approved and Deposit Taken ***
$495
- 2
- 1
- 0
Affordable and Convenient space *** Application Approved and Deposit Taken ***
Listing ID: 38268908